When diagnosing issues that occur with SAS Enterprise Miner client or workstation, it might be necessary to launch the application using a command-line method. The command-line method is one alternative that simplifies the launch process by directly launching the Java application. This simplified process enables launch issues to be isolated and identified more quickly. The command-line method that follows also enables advanced diagnostics that are detailed in the following SAS Note:
At a high level, this alternative method requires three steps:
From the Start menu, locate the 'Search programs and files' text box. Type: cmd
In the results list above the text box, right-click the cmd.exe link/icon, and choose Run as administrator.
With an Administrator Command Prompt open, navigate to the product location. To begin this step, the product location must be identified:
<SASHome>\<product>\<version>\
Example: if you are attempting to launch SAS Enterprise Miner Workstation 13.1, then the product location is this:
<SASHome>\SASEnterpriseMinerWorkstationConfiguration\13.1\After you have identified the product location, execute the cd command within the Administrator Command Prompt using the identified location as an argument. Example:
cd "C:\Program Files\SASHome\SASEnterpriseMinerWorkstationConfiguration\13.1\"
With an Administrator Command Prompt opened at the product location, execute the appropriate Java command. The first task for this step is to identify the appropriate Java command. There are three different options provided here to determine the appropriate Java command. After you have determined the command, execute this command within the Administrator Command Prompt at the product location as illustrated below in order to launch SAS Enterprise Miner client or workstation:
The following sample commands are from basic installations that are deployed to default locations. For default installations and configurations, these commands can be used with little or no editing.
SAS Enterprise Miner workstation 13.1
With SAS Enterprise Miner client or workstation running, launch Microsoft Process Explorer (available for download: http://technet.microsoft.com/en-us/sysinternals/bb896653.aspx). Find the java.exe process that is associated with em.exe:
Right-click the process, and choose Properties. Within the Properties window, find the Command line:
The Command line displays the command that you need to execute from the product location within an Administrator Command prompt.
Using the em.ini file, and the sassw.config file, the Java command can be constructed. The default location for these files is displayed below:
<SASHome>\SASEnterpriseMiner*\<version>\em.ini <SASHome>\sassw.configUsing the values from these files, construct the command using this format:
<JREHOME> <JavaArgs_1> <JavaArgs_2> ... <JavaArgs_n> -cp <VJRHOME>\eclipse\plugins\sas.launcher.jar <MainClass>
